    About Zip Code 24112

    Zip code 24112 is located in Martinsville, Virginia, within Henry County. Home to approximately 30,862 residents, this area sits at an elevation of 970 ft and falls within the Eastern (EST/EDT) timezone. The local area code is 540.

    The median household income is $47,059 per year, which is below the national median of $70,784. Homes in this zip code have a median value of $119,200, and the cost of living index is 60 (40% below the national average of 100).

    Summers average a high of 88°F while winters drop to 24°F. The area receives about 47 in of rain and 9 in of snow annually. The zip code covers 151.7 square miles of land area and 0.9 square miles of water.
